#21bd88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#21bd88 is composed of 12.9% red, 74.1%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 159.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 43.5%. #21bd88 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#007b11.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#21bd88 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#21bd88 has RGB values of R:33, G:189,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 2211208.

Hex triplet 21bd88 #21bd88
RGB Decimal 33, 189, 136 rgb(33,189,136)
RGB Percent 12.9, 74.1, 53.3 rgb(12.9%,74.1%,53.3%)
CMYK 83, 0, 28, 26
HSL 159.6°, 70.3, 43.5 hsl(159.6,70.3%,43.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 159.6°, 82.5, 74.1
Web Safe 33cc99 #33cc99
CIE-LAB 68.383, -50.941, 16.08
XYZ 23.267, 38.494, 29.495
xyY 0.255, 0.422, 38.494
CIE-LCH 68.383, 53.419, 162.481
CIE-LUV 68.383, -55.823, 30.554
Hunter-Lab 62.043, -41.637, 15.244
Binary 00100001, 10111101, 10001000

Shades and Tints of #21bd88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#21bd88 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#888888 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#739388 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b6ab84 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c2a597 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#53b8c6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#80b186 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#87ae91 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#41baaf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
